Hollies Got Hosed

Poor Hollies (in the US, anway). Trackitis worse than The Beatles, Stones, or Kinks could image. Beside the tossing of tracks around, all albums except Evolution and Distant Light had their titles changed when shipped across the pond. One album, In The Hollies Style, was ignored completely. Plus a lot of orphan singles over here.

Shocker: Album Title & Tracks Are The Same!

This album was one of two that survived the trip across the Atlantic unmolested.

Anywho, this album's got that big hit single—a staple of rock stations in 'Murica. #2 on Billboard and #1 on Cashbox (their biggest hit here), but suprisingly only #32 on their home turf. The album didn't even make the UK charts either. Lead singer Clarke had quit the band before the album was released, but agreed to rejoin after the hit.
